Sangho Ko is a leading researcher in mechanical and aerospace systems, specializing in the modeling, simulation, and control of electromechanical actuators (EMAs) and their dynamic components. His major contributions center on advancing the understanding and estimation of backlash dynamics in worm-wheel systems—a critical challenge for replacing traditional hydraulic actuators with quieter, lighter, and more eco-friendly EMAs in aerospace applications. By developing sophisticated Kalman filter-based techniques for gap size estimation, Ko has enabled more precise and reliable actuator performance, directly impacting the design of next-generation flight control systems.
